Tarrant County Residents need transit that is Economically Productive

Instead of focusing on transit agencies as a for-profit business, communities should look at modal return on investment (ROI) as a part of a whole, healthy municipal system.


Transit-Oriented Development (TOD) is important for the economic health of our community, placemaking & access. In a study of The Economic and Fiscal Impacts of Development Near DART Light-Rail Stations, researchers concluded that the studied TODs around DART’s light rail “... added billions in economic activity for the DFW economy, [and] will serve as a catalyst for future economic growth.” (Shattles and Ball 2020)
